FIRST BORN PROGRAM OF LOS ALAMOS, founded in 2013,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$509K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ue grew 13%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ion.

Mission

First Born Los Alamos provides relationship-based home visiting to empower and support first-time parents and caregivers of children prenatal to age 5 and create connections with community and resources to optimize the development of safe thriving young children and families
